SRK and Kajol to shoot Comedy Nights episode at Film City on Nov 30

​ On Sunday, November 30, Shah Rukh Khan and Kajol will head down to Mumbai's Film City to shoot an episode of the television show   Comedy Nights with Kapil . The special appearance by the two Bollywood stars will mark 19 years since their 1995 romantic blockbuster   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ge  was released. According to IBTimes, the actors will share memories and anecdotes about the making of the film. "Comedy Nights is the perfect platform for the celebration, considering that DDLJ was the first film to have a thirty minute television show chronicling its making which was telecast on the national broadcaster Doordarshan," said a recent news report in the daily newspaper Mumbai Mirror. DDLJ , one of India's best-loved films, will also complete a 1,000-week run at Mumbai's Maratha Mandir cinema on December 12.  DDLJ  has been showing at the 50-year-old cinema daily since October 20, 1995. Wishes galore for birthday boy Shah Rukh Khan

Shah Rukh Khan, one of the most popular and celebrated stars of the Hindi film industry, turned 49 Sunday. Who's who of the filmdom wished the man "who creates his own perception and dares to think out of the box!" It's a double celebration for SRK as his just released "Happy New Year", a typical Bollywood potboiler directed by Farah Khan, hit the right notes and set the cash registers ringing. It made the quickest Rs.100 crore. His birthday celebrations started Saturday night and fans assembled outside his house Mannat here to wish him. He came out to greet his eager fans and later tweeted, "So many beautiful people outside Mannat. Thank you all for celebrating my birthday with such ownership and love. Very humbling..."
